The Youth Wing of the National Democratic Congress (NDC) has announced a nationwide “uprising” dubbed ‘No Salary Uprising’ to demand the withdrawal of a decision to pay monthly salaries to the spouses of the President and the Vice President.

The NDC youth say it is surprising that at a time President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o has admonished all Ghanaians to make sacrifices, he gave a clean bill of health to Parliament to approve the report of the Professor Yaa Ntiamoah-Baidu-led committee, which reviewed the emoluments of Article 71 office holders.

“The terms of reference of the Prof Yaa Ntiamoah-Baidu Committee gave out the President as the chief architect of the decision to pay his wife, Mrs Rebecca Akufo-Addo, and wife of Vice President, Mrs Samira Bawumia,” a press release issued by NDC’s National Youth Organiser George Opare Addo accused.

“For want of a better expression, the decision to further drain the Consolidated Fund with needless expenditure is a pet project of President Akufo-Addo.”



Mr Opare Addo served notice that the party will be heading to the Supreme Court to “declare this cancerous and insensitive act unconstitutional”.

“By this circular, we announce the #NoSalaryUprising across the nation by the young people of this country until this obnoxious development is reversed.”
